The Evolution of Registration Procedures in Online Casinos
Traditionally, land-based casinos relied on physical identification and in-person verification methods. The advent of internet gambling shifted this paradigm towards digital registration forms, where users provide personal data such as name, date of birth, address, and payment details. Over time, these procedures have become more sophisticated, integrating multi-factor authentication (MFA), automated identity verification, and real-time fraud detection systems to combat identity theft and money laundering.
For instance, many platforms incorporate biometric login options or document upload features directly within their registration workflows, streamlining the onboarding process while maintaining high security standards. These innovations help establish trust between the platform and its users, which is vital given the financial stakes involved in online betting and gaming.
Security Technologies in Modern Registration Systems
Effective registration systems leverage a combination of encryption, secure servers, and advanced verification tools to protect user data. Encryption protocols, such as SSL/TLS, ensure that data transmitted between the user and the server cannot be intercepted or tampered with. Identity verification methods may include biometric scans, government-issued ID validation, and database cross-referencing against criminal or fraud watchlists.
| Technique | Description |
|---|---|
| Document Uploads | Users submit scanned copies of IDs, utility bills, or bank statements for identity confirmation. |
| Two-Factor Authentication (2FA) | Upon registration, users verify their identity via a second device or method, such as a code sent via SMS. |
| Behavioral Analytics | Monitoring registration patterns to detect suspicious activity or inconsistencies in provided data. |
These security measures collectively help prevent unauthorized access and ensure regulatory compliance, particularly in jurisdictions that require extensive Know Your Customer (KYC) protocols.

Legal and Ethical Considerations in User Registration
Beyond security, ethical considerations include ensuring user data privacy and compliance with local regulations. Responsible online operators implement transparent policies, including clear terms on data usage and retention. Moreover, they often conduct rigorous age and identity verification to prevent underage gambling, which is legally prohibited in many regions.
